Agnès Burel
About
Agnès Burel has authored 33 papers that have received a total of 539 indexed citations.
This includes 13 papers in Molecular Biology, 11 papers in Materials Chemistry and 5 papers in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is. The topics of these papers are Nanoparticles: synthesis and applications (7 papers), Heavy Metal Exposure and Toxicity (4 papers) and Aluminum toxicity and tolerance in plants and animals (3 papers). Agnès Burel is often cited by papers focused on Nanoparticles: synthesis and applications (7 papers), Heavy Metal Exposure and Toxicity (4 papers) and Aluminum toxicity and tolerance in plants and animals (3 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in France, Germany and Luxembourg. Agnès Burel's co-authors include Fabienne Gauffre, Soizic Chevance, Odile Sergent, Alfonso Lampen and Dominique Lagadic‐Gossmann and has published in prestigious journals such as Development, PLANT PHYSIOLOGY and Langmuir
